## Break-Glass: Scanlark Barcode Integration

Hey plugin folks — if the Scanlark barcode bridge stops accepting scans and the admin API returns nothing but 503s, you've probably hit a sealed credential store. Normal fix: wait for the token refresh (about ten minutes). Can't wait? Break-glass it. Grab the emergency CLI, point it at your sandbox, and confirm you understand this gets audited. When the CLI asks for it, type the recovery passphrase below.

strongbox words: fraath-isteth

Vendor note for new team members: canary gating on the Bramblewick platform is enforced by our vendor, Opaline Systems, not by us. Their Gatewright tool holds each canary at 5% traffic until error rate, latency p95, and saturation all pass for 30 minutes. We cannot override the hold; only Opaline's release desk can. Document any gating dispute in the vendor log before requesting an exception. For exception requests, write to their release desk directly.

alerts address for bahaf-kaduf: zorox@qorvelio.internal

## Runbook: Connection Pool Changes

Plugin authors integrating with the Ostermill data layer: release 7.1 caps per-plugin pool size at twelve connections and enforces a two-second acquisition timeout. Audit your plugins for long-held connections and release them promptly, or requests will queue and time out. After updating, run the pool stress check in the sandbox. Signed plugin packages only — sign your archive with the key below.

release key, fafof-hawip: bky6_52YEwQ

Visitor policy — cleaning crew. Contracted cleaners from Ostwell Facilities are classed as recurring visitors and must sign the evening register at the Danbury Street entrance. Team assistants should confirm the crew roster each Monday and report any unfamiliar personnel to security straight away. Cleaners may not enter the records room unescorted under any circumstances. For all other areas, the crew uses the door code provided below.

staff pass of kawip-hawef = bdg-QLP-2